As opkglibdir starts with a /, os.path.join will ignore
self.target_rootfs, leading to an attempt to remove /var/lib/opkg.
This only fails if it exists on the host, explaining why this remained
undiscovered for long.

If there already is a package providing (and conflicting against)
packages what should be installed, apt will try remove the conflicting
package (target-sdk-provides-dummy) and any that depend on it (like apt
and dpkg). This usually fails because of the protection of essential
packages. In that case, no -dev/-dbg packages are installed to the SDK.
Avoid this problem by checking which packages are already provided and
removing them from the list to be installed. Also sort the list to make
it easier to read when debugging.

pseudo-native is special in that bitbake ends up executing it from the
sysroot-components directory before we have any workdirs for the bitbake
fakeroot worker. Since we switched to dynamically linking sqlite, it
means sqlite from the host system may be found, we really want the version
in sysroot-components. Trying to run tasks to create some special environment
for pseudo is hard and error prone. The simplest fix is to add an RPATH to
the binary so that it can correctly find the sqlite we want.
Unfortunately passing $ORIGIN into make doesn't work so well with shell
quoting so we have to fix that during do_install.

systemd supports a distribution hwdb.bin in /usr/lib/udev/hwdb.bin,
which is used if /etc/udev/hwdb.bin is not present. When generating the
install time hwdb, for systemd, ensure that we put it in /usr/lib/udev,
which then ensures that at boot time we do not regenerate it, unless the
system is marked for update.
This allows fragments dropped into /etc/udev/hwdb.d to be processed
correctly, but without requiring a first boot time build:

udev is packaged before systemd so any wildcard inclusions in FILES will
override later specifics. List all udev rules explicitly so that the
systemd specific rules, packaged alongside systemd, appear in the
correct package.
